The Royal Irish Academy of Music is delighted to announce a new call for an Accompaniment Fellow. This Fellowship provides an opportunity for an emerging professional pianist with accompaniment experience and excellent sight-reading skills to gain widespread experience within one of Ireland’s premier music conservatoires.

One Fellowship is offered for instrumental accompaniment.

Fellowship terms and conditions

  • Two year appointment from September 2017
  • Stipend: €10,000 per annum
  • Approximate workload: 400 contact hours per annum
